Newspaper in Education Program
Since 1989, Kruger has participated in the international “Newspaper in Education” program, which was set up in 1955 to promote using newspapers in the classroom as learning tools for reading, spelling and writing. The company offers $25 per 100 metric tons of newsprint sold to all customers who participate in this program. These donations are made through the Gene H. Kruger Fund.

Gene-H.-Kruger Scholarship Fund
Sherbrooke University
Kruger has been established as a major company in the Sherbrooke area for nearly 50 years, and the Company made a substantial donation to the 1988-92 University of Sherbrooke Financing Campaign to create an endowment fund bearing the name of its founder, Mr. Gene H. Kruger. The scholarships for excellence generated by this fund are awarded to second-year students studying chemistry or chemical engineering.

Laval University – Québec City
Kruger and its affiliated companies are active participants in educational institution communities. For example, for the past 15 years, students in the forestry faculty of Laval University have been organizing annual colloquia sponsored entirely by the Company, as a part of Forest Sciences Week.

Gannett Corp. repays Kruger,
who passes it on…
In December 2006, the students of Bedford school in the Côte-des-Neiges area of Montreal, a school that is near Kruger’s head office, benefited from a $10,000 donation, which our company had received from Gannett Corp. when our Publication Papers business unit was awarded their prize for the best supplier of the year.
In a letter of November 29 to Mr. Joseph Kruger II, Mrs. Hélène Bourdages, Director of Bedford School, and Mrs. Édith Blain, chair of the school’s board, thanked him for his generosity to the students of Bedford School, a neighbour of Kruger’s head office.

“Bedford School is a well-known institution in our city and we are proud to see that there is a golden and joyous link along Bedford Road between our two institutions. Thanks to your generosity, we will be able to provide our students with a multimedia room, supplied with state-of-the-art equipment, including a giant screen and loudspeakers like the ones in the cinema. A sum of $500 will be used to buy school supplies for students whose families cannot afford them.”
